Patch 5: Creates /dev/dazukofs.ign as an (optional) mechanism for any
         processes to hide themselves from DazukoFS file access
         control.

Patched against 2.6.29-rc3.

+struct dazukofs_proc {
+	struct list_head list;
+	struct task_struct *curr;
+};
+
+static struct dazukofs_proc ign_list;
+static struct mutex ign_list_mutex;
+static struct kmem_cache *dazukofs_ign_cachep;
+
+int dazukofs_check_ignore_process(void)
+{
+	struct list_head *pos;
+	struct dazukofs_proc *proc;
+	int found = 0;
+
+	mutex_lock(&ign_list_mutex);
+	list_for_each(pos, &ign_list.list) {
+		proc = list_entry(pos, struct dazukofs_proc, list);
+		if (proc->curr == current) {
+			found = 1;
+			break;
+		}
+	}
+	mutex_unlock(&ign_list_mutex);
+
+	return !found;
+}
+
+static int dazukofs_add_ign(struct file *file)
+{
+	struct dazukofs_proc *proc =
+		kmem_cache_zalloc(dazukofs_ign_cachep, G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(!proc) {
+		file->private_data = NULL;
+		return -ENOMEM;
+	}
+
+	file->private_data = proc;
+	proc->curr = current;
+
+	mutex_lock(&ign_list_mutex);
+	list_add(&proc->list, &ign_list.list);
+	mutex_unlock(&ign_list_mutex);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static void dazukofs_remove_ign(struct file *file)
+{
+	struct list_head *pos;
+	struct dazukofs_proc *proc = NULL;
+	struct dazukofs_proc *check_proc = file->private_data;
+	int found = 0;
+
+	if (!check_proc)
+		return;
+
+	mutex_lock(&ign_list_mutex);
+	list_for_each(pos, &ign_list.list) {
+		proc = list_entry(pos, struct dazukofs_proc, list);
+		if (proc->curr == check_proc->curr) {
+			found = 1;
+			list_del(pos);
+			break;
+		}
+	}
+	mutex_unlock(&ign_list_mutex);
+
+	if (found) {
+		file->private_data = NULL;
+		kmem_cache_free(dazukofs_ign_cachep, proc);
+	}
+}
+
+static int dazukofs_ign_open(struct inode *inode, struct file *file)
+{
+	return dazukofs_add_ign(file);
+}
+
+static int dazukofs_ign_release(struct inode *inode, struct file *file)
+{
+	dazukofs_remove_ign(file);
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static void dazukofs_destroy_ignlist(void)
+{
+	struct list_head *pos;
+	struct list_head *q;
+	struct dazukofs_proc *proc;
+
+	list_for_each_safe(pos, q, &ign_list.list) {
+		proc = list_entry(pos, struct dazukofs_proc, list);
+		list_del(pos);
+		kmem_cache_free(dazukofs_ign_cachep, proc);
+	}
+}
+
+static struct cdev ign_cdev;
+
+static const struct file_operations ign_fops = {
+	.owner		= THIS_MODULE,
+	.open		= dazukofs_ign_open,
+	.release	= dazukofs_ign_release,
+};
+
+int dazukofs_ign_dev_init(int dev_major, int dev_minor,
+			  struct class *dazukofs_class)
+{
+	int err = 0;
+	struct device *dev;
+
+	INIT_LIST_HEAD(&ign_list.list);
+	mutex_init(&ign_list_mutex);
+
+	dazukofs_ign_cachep =
+		kmem_cache_create("dazukofs_ign_cache",
+				  sizeof(struct dazukofs_proc), 0,
+				  SLAB_HWCACHE_ALIGN, NULL);
+	if (!dazukofs_ign_cachep) {
+		err = -ENOMEM;
+		goto error_out1;
+	}
+
+	/* setup cdev for ignore */
+	cdev_init(&ign_cdev, &ign_fops);
+	ign_cdev.owner = THIS_MODULE;
+	err = cdev_add(&ign_cdev, MKDEV(dev_major, dev_minor), 1);
+	if (err)
+		goto error_out2;
+
+	/* create ignore device */
+	dev = device_create(dazukofs_class, NULL, MKDEV(dev_major, dev_minor),
+			    NULL, "%s.ign", DEVICE_NAME);
+	if (IS_ERR(dev)) {
+		err = PTR_ERR(dev);
+		goto error_out3;
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+
+error_out3:
+	cdev_del(&ign_cdev);
+error_out2:
+	dazukofs_destroy_ignlist();
+	kmem_cache_destroy(dazukofs_ign_cachep);
+error_out1:
+	return err;
+}
+
+void dazukofs_ign_dev_destroy(int dev_major, int dev_minor,
+			      struct class *dazukofs_class)
+{
+	device_destroy(dazukofs_class, MKDEV(dev_major, dev_minor));
+	cdev_del(&ign_cdev);
+	dazukofs_destroy_ignlist();
+	kmem_cache_destroy(dazukofs_ign_cachep);
+}

+All processes on the system that try to access files on a DazukoFS mount will
+require authorization (if at least one group exists). This is also true for
+registered process that try to access files on a DazukoFS mount.
+
+IMPORTANT: If registered processes access files on a DazukoFS mount, they
+           will cause new file access events that must be authorized. This
+           could lead to deadlock if not properly considered.
+
+Since the registered process receives an open file descriptor to the file
+being accessed, there should be no need for that process to open other
+files. However, if the process must open additional files (and these
+files potentially lie on a DazukoFS mount), it is possible for processes
+to hide themselves from DazukoFS.
+
+By opening the /dev/dazukofs.ign device, a process will be ignored by
+DazukoFS. It does not matter if the process is registered or not. No data
+must be written or read from the device. It simply needs to be opened.
+
+WARNING: Make sure the permissions for /dev/dazukofs.ign are securely
+         set. Otherwise, any process could potentially hide itself.
+
+As soon as the /dev/dazukofs.ign device is closed, the process is no
+longer hidden.
